The Los Angeles Dodgers (-200) visit Coors Field to take on the Colorado Rockies (+165) on Wednesday, June 29, 2022. First pitch is scheduled for 8:40pm EDT in Denver.
The Dodgers are betting favorites in this MLB matchup, with the run line sitting at -2.5 (+105).
The Dodgers vs Rockies Over/Under is 11.5 total runs for the game.
So far this season, the Dodgers are 45-28 against the spread (ATS), while the Rockies are 39-36 ATS.

Julio Urías: Dodgers Starting Pitcher Stats & Trends
Julio Urias has a strike rate of 73% (732/1,008) vs left-handed batters since the start of last season — highest in MLB among starting pitchers with at least 116 total IP; League Avg: 64% — 100th Percentile.
Julio Urias has allowed an average Exit Velocity of just 82.8 MPH with runners in scoring position since the start of last season (115 balls in play) — 2nd best in MLB among starting pitchers with at least 116 total IP; League Avg: 88.0
Julio Urias has allowed an average Exit Velocity of just 87.9 MPH on pitches in the strike zone since the start of last season (565 balls in play) — best in MLB among starting pitchers with at least 116 total IP; League Avg: 90.8
Opponents are hitting just .150 (6-for-40) against Julio Urias on inside fastballs this season — 3rd best among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: .261 — 96th Percentile.
Germán Márquez: Rockies Starting Pitcher Stats & Trends
Opponents are hitting .421 (24-for-57) against German Marquez on inside fastballs this season — 2nd highest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: .261 — third Percentile.
German Marquez has allowed a slugging percentage of .789 (45 Total Bases / 57 ABs) on inside fastballs this season — highest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: .420 — first Percentile.
German Marquez has allowed an OPS of .919 (168 PA’s) against right-handed batters this season — highest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: .673 — first Percentile.
German Marquez has allowed a slugging percentage of .574 (89 Total Bases / 155 ABs) against right-handed batters this season — highest among qualified SPs in MLB; League Avg: .380 — first Percentile.
